Stage 1

Between the Hills

September 8, 2026 · Saint Jean Pied-de-Port to Roncesvalles · 15.71 miles

🥾 15.71 mi ⬆️ 1544m gain 🌤 Overcast early morning transitioning to blue sky day after the morning mist burned away.

Today’s climb over the Pyrenees was physically grueling. Every time I thought we had crossed the summit, I’d see another upward path ahead. It felt like our ascent would never end.

Despite that, I found myself smiling often, stopping regularly in awe or wonder over something I had observed, or connecting with someone experiencing it all with me, both the pleasing and the painful.

It’s like life, isn’t it? As long as we live, there will always be another hill to climb. The lesson is to take the time to appreciate the joys scattered among the peaks and valleys.

The journey is never really over, and I don’t want it to be. I found that the hard work made me appreciate the simple joys all the more.

The joys that got me through today were simple and free, but they made the exertion worthwhile. And, in turn, the sweat and aching muscles that delivered me to them made those simple joys all the more satisfying: the sound of buckets clinking somewhere unseen in the morning fog as farmers milked their cows; cowbells ringing through the mist below the path; the grassy, herbal smell of the morning air; the sound of dewy condensate dripping from the trees, as if each contained its own localized shower; the sun as it first broke through the morning mist; ephemeral rainbows appearing and disappearing to the west; so many sheep; horses; wild blackberries, baking in the sun, past their prime, sweet and jammy like raisins; standing above the clouds; and meeting like-minded travelers from all over the world.

I’m so thankful for some meaningful connections I made today, and for what we accomplished and experienced together.

Tomorrow is another day. There will certainly be more hills as we continue to Zubiri.

But today was a good reminder that the hills aren’t really the point.
